Wemyss Caves

Step into Scotland's ancient past at the Wemyss Caves, home to the largest collection of Pictish carvings dating back 1,500 years. Guided Sunday tours reveal mysterious symbols etched into these coastal caverns.

St Serf's Church Tower

This six-storey medieval tower from 1500 stands as the last remnant of St Serf's Church, showcasing Scotland's finest battlemented church architecture. Photograph its dramatic silhouette against the sky.

Best time to go to Kirkcaldy

The best time to visit Kirkcaldy can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Kirkcaldy falls in July, when vis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ain. The coolest average temperature in Kirkcaldy falls in January,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January38.7°F (3.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
February39.6°F (4.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
March41.9°F (5.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
April45.1°F (7.3°C)No RainMostly CloudySlightly HighAverage
May50.0°F (10.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
June55.2°F (12.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
July58.3°F (14.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ly High
August57.6°F (14.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
September54.5°F (12.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ighAverage
October49.6°F (9.8°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age
November43.9°F (6.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age
December39.7°F (4.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age

What is the best area to stay in Kirkcaldy?
The best area to stay in Kirkcaldy is generally close to the town centre, particularly around the Esplanade and High Street, offering convenience and access to amenities.This central area is the heart of Kirkcaldy, running parallel to the Firth of Forth. You'll find many shops, restaurants, and local businesses along the High Street. The Esplanade, just a stone's throw away, offers pleasant walks along the seafront, with views across the water. Key landmarks include the Adam Smith Theatre and the Mercat Shopping Centre.For couples looking for a relaxed break, staying near the Esplanade is a great option. You can enjoy strolls by the sea, dine at local restaurants with sea views, and easily reach the town centre for a bit of shopping or a show. The proximity to the train station also makes day trips to Edinburgh or other parts of Fife straightforward.Families will find the area around the High Street practical. There are plenty of eateries suiting different tastes, and the Mercat Shopping Centre provides convenient access to essentials.

Where can I find the best nightlife in Kirkcaldy?
Kirkcaldy has a few areas with evening options, though it's not known for extensive nightlife compared to larger cities.The High Street, particularly the section closer to the town square, has a selection of pubs and a couple of bars. You'll find traditional Scottish pubs offering a relaxed atmosphere, often with live music on weekends. There are also a few places that stay open a bit later, serving cocktails and spirits.The Esplanade, running along the waterfront, has a few establishments that are popular for evening drinks, especially during warmer months. These often have views of the Firth of Forth and provide a more casual setting, sometimes with outdoor seating.The Oriel Road area, near the train station, has a couple of pubs that are popular with locals.
